Brandon Marshall and Geno Smith are living together

Brandon Marshall and Geno Smith are so determined to build chemistry as teammates with the New York Jets that they have decided to move in together.

According to Brian Costello of the New York Post, Marshall moved into Smith’s New Jersey home about a month ago. The two have a close relationship and got together in South Florida to work out shortly after the Jets acquired Marshall from the Chicago Bears back in March.

“This is a first-year offense,” Marshall said. “If you guys are expecting me to be a [1,500]-yard receiver, that’s high expectations. If you’re expecting Geno Smith to go out there and crush it, I don’t know how possible that is. It’s a first-year offense with new guys, new faces. We’re behind the eight ball. We have to put in extra work to catch up to those guys that have been together five, six, seven years.”

Marshall said he has been impressed with Smith’s maturity level and how much he already knows about the game of football.

“I was just blown away by his maturity and how much he knows,” he said. “This kid is really smart. The sky is the limit for him.”

Smith, a former West Virginia star, is entering a pivotal third season. He appeared in 25 games for the Jets over the past two seasons and threw 25 touchdowns and a whopping 34 interceptions during that span. He needs to do a better job of protecting the football, and having a true possession receiver like Marshall should help.

The Jets drafted former Baylor quarterback Bryce Petty in the fourth round, but new offensive coordinator Chan Gailey recently said he expects Smith to be the starter.

If Marshall and Eric Decker can stay healthy, Smith could have one of the better wide receiver duos in the league. But if Smith struggles like he did last year, problems could arise quickly in New York. We saw the way Marshall’s relationship with his last quarterback ended, after all.
